Delving into the meaning behind B1A4's "Solo Day (Japanese Version)", one cannot help but appreciate the emotional depth conveyed through the lyrics. The song explores themes of solitude, freedom, and acceptance in a way that connects with listeners on a personal level.

The opening lines, "Not everything can be expressed in words / Maybe not once", set a somber yet introspective tone. This reflects the idea that sometimes emotions are too complex to articulate, and the struggle of expressing oneself authentically. The line "Are you still there? Did you forget me?" highlights the feelings of isolation and abandonment that come with being alone.

The chorus, "Solo solo day / Happiness just for me / Solo solo day / Feeling so good", is a celebration of individuality and self-acceptance. It emphasizes the importance of finding joy in one's own company and not depending on others to validate or define one's happiness.

The lyrics, "Different from everyone else / I want to flow freely like a cloud", signify the desire for freedom and independence. This could be interpreted as a call to break free from societal norms and expectations that may hold us back. The line, "With a calm face, acting coolly", portrays the confidence of being true to oneself, even in the face of criticism or prejudice.

The song also touches upon themes of introspection and reflection, as evidenced by lines such as, "Every day it sinks in / That I am all alone today". This highlights the importance of taking time for oneself and recognizing one's own thoughts and feelings.

The final chorus, "Solo solo day / Happiness just for me / Solo solo day / Feeling so good", is a powerful reminder that being alone does not have to be a negative experience. It encourages listeners to embrace their solitude and find happiness in themselves.

In summary, B1A4's "Solo Day (Japanese Version)" is an empowering anthem that celebrates individuality, freedom, and self-acceptance. Its themes of introspection, independence, and happiness in solitude strike a chord with listeners on a personal level, making it more than just a catchy tune but a powerful message of finding joy and fulfillment within oneself.
